The Grand County Concert series is proud to announce its 2009-2010 season. If you love music, we think you’ll enjoy the concert series.
Since 2004 the Grand County Concert Series has been bringing classical music to the Fraser Valley. The 2009-2010 season features five new performances and one returning group. With the exception of the American Horn Quartet on Saturday, February 27, the concerts are held on Friday nights starting at 7 p.m. at the beautiful Church of the Eternal Hills in Tabernash. Each concert is followed by a complimentary dessert reception with the artists.
